package http import ( "testing" "reflect" smithy "github.com/aws/smithy-go" ) func TestSigV4SigningName(t *testing.T) { expected := "foo" var m smithy.Properties SetSigV4SigningName(&m, expected) actual, _ := GetSigV4SigningName(&m) if expected != actual { t.Errorf("Expect SigV4SigningName to be equivalent %s != %s", expected, actual) } } func TestSigV4SigningRegion(t *testing.T) { expected := "foo" var m smithy.Properties SetSigV4SigningRegion(&m, expected) actual, _ := GetSigV4SigningRegion(&m) if expected != actual { t.Errorf("Expect SigV4SigningRegion to be equivalent %s != %s", expected, actual) } } func TestSigV4ASigningName(t *testing.T) { expected := "foo" var m smithy.Properties SetSigV4ASigningName(&m, expected) actual, _ := GetSigV4ASigningName(&m) if expected != actual { t.Errorf("Expect SigV4ASigningName to be equivalent %s != %s", expected, actual) } } func TestSigV4SigningRegions(t *testing.T) { expected := []string{"foo", "bar"} var m smithy.Properties SetSigV4ASigningRegions(&m, expected) actual, _ := GetSigV4ASigningRegions(&m) if !reflect.DeepEqual(expected, actual) { t.Errorf("Expect SigV4ASigningRegions to be equivalent %v != %v", expected, actual) } } func TestUnsignedPayload(t *testing.T) { expected := true var m smithy.Properties SetIsUnsignedPayload(&m, expected) actual, _ := GetIsUnsignedPayload(&m) if expected != actual { t.Errorf("Expect IsUnsignedPayload to be equivalent %v != %v", expected, actual) } } func TestDisableDoubleEncoding(t *testing.T) { expected := true var m smithy.Properties SetDisableDoubleEncoding(&m, expected) actual, _ := GetDisableDoubleEncoding(&m) if expected != actual { t.Errorf("Expect DisableDoubleEncoding to be equivalent %v != %v", expected, actual) } }
